Jennifer McMasters Vann 1967-2020

PURCELLVILLE, Va. — Jennifer Lynn McMasters Vann, 52, died peacefully Thursday, Oct. 1, 2020, at her home, after a brief illness.

Jennifer was born in Youngstown on Nov. 14, 1967, the daughter of David A. McMasters and Carol Holtzman McMasters. Jennifer was a 1986 graduate of Springfield Local High School, where she was a member of the National Honor Society, a prom court attendant and editor of the school newspaper.

In 1990, she graduated from the E.W. Scripps School of Journalism at Ohio University. She was employed at HistoryNet as the art director for their America’s Civil War and Civil War Times magazines. She was also highly regarded for her freelance design work for a number of organizations. Jennifer loved photography, art, concerts, traveling, good wine and the OU Bobcats. She loved and cared about her family, her friends and her coworkers.

She leaves to cherish her memory, her parents, Carol and John Beard of New Middletown; her husband, Stephen Vann of Purcellville, Va.; her sister, Beth McMasters of Abingdon, Md.; her stepbrother, John T. Beard (Jill Damiano) of Springfield Township; her stepsister, Lisa Major of Struthers; and a stepson, Christopher Vann and five grandchildren of Virginia. She also leaves numerous aunts, uncles, nieces, nephews, cousins and her beloved rescue dog, Mia.

She was preceded in death by her father, David McMasters; her maternal grandparents, George and Jennie Holtzman; and her paternal grandparents, Russell and Eleanor McMasters, and Arthur and Elizabeth Beard.

On Oct. 17, 2020, a memorial Yoshino Cherry tree was planted at the Virginia State Arboretum, followed by a Celebration of Life at Sunset Hills Vineyard. A similar memorial tree planting and Celebration of Life will be held locally in the spring of 2021.
